MILITARY DEPARTMENT Since his arrival in September of 1965, Major Frank T. Chance has done much to spark the morale of R.O.T.C. participators. Addition of new uniforms, competition with other schools, and thorough dis- cussion of current problems in Military Science classes have given the boys many reasons for an avid interest in the military. Under the Major’s direction are the Grenadiers, the Girls’ Drill Team, and the Boys’ and Girls’ Rifle Teams. Many boys choose to enter the military after graduation, and the skills taught by Major Chance and his fine staff are very helpful to them. S SGT.
